Community & Collaboration Workshop: #WeCount: Collaborating with clinicians and academics to track abortions
The U.S. Supreme Court decision in Dobbs v Jackson Women's Health Organization allowed new state-level restrictions on abortion access.To document the impact of these restrictions, a large team of researchers and clinicians worked together to track the number of abortions during the period after Dobbs. IPR affiliates Alison Norris and Mikaela Smith will present findings from this effort and discuss the challenges of managing a multiorganizational, time-sensitive, geographically dispersed data collection project.
